虚拟主机是否有独立IP?
卡尔云官网
www.kaeryun.com
在互联网世界中,IP地址是一个至关重要的概念,IP地址就像是一个地址,用于标识网络上的设备,对于虚拟主机来说,情况可能与你想象的有所不同,让我来为你详细解答这个问题。
什么是虚拟主机?
虚拟主机并不是一个物理存在的设备,而是通过软件实现的虚拟化服务,它允许你在同一台物理服务器上运行多个网站,每个网站都可以有自己的域名(如example.com)和网站内容,虚拟主机的作用就是将不同的域名映射到同一台服务器上,以便这些域名可以共享相同的网络资源。
IP地址的作用
IP地址是互联网通信中使用的地址,用于标识网络上的设备,每个IP地址都是唯一的,确保不同设备之间能够正确通信,当你打开一个网页时,浏览器会发送请求到一个IP地址,服务器会响应返回页面。
虚拟主机与IP的关系
在虚拟主机的情况下,所有连接到该虚拟主机的域名都会共享同一个IP地址,这意味着,如果你有一个虚拟主机服务,它可能只有一个IP地址,而你可能拥有多个域名(如example.com、sub.example.com等),这些域名都会指向同一个IP地址。
举个例子,假设你有一个虚拟主机服务,IP地址为192.168.1.100,如果你注册了两个域名:example.com和sub.example.com,那么当你访问example.com时,浏览器会发送请求到IP地址192.168.1.100,而服务器会将响应返回给example.com的请求,同样地,sub.example.com也会发送请求到同一个IP地址192.168.1.100,服务器也会将响应返回给sub.example.com的请求。
域名解析的作用
在虚拟主机的情况下,域名解析是实现域名与IP地址之间映射的关键,域名解析将域名分解为子域名,并最终指向一个IP地址,example.com可以分解为example和com,这两个子域名都会指向同一个IP地址。
通过域名解析,虚拟主机可以支持多个域名,每个域名都可以有自己的网站和内容,但它们共享同一个IP地址,这意味着,即使你拥有多个域名,只要它们共享同一个IP地址,你只需要管理一个虚拟主机服务即可。
虚拟主机的IP地址分配
在实际操作中,虚拟主机的IP地址通常由虚拟主机服务提供商分配,这些提供商会将多个域名分配到同一个IP地址上,以便它们可以共享相同的网络资源,如带宽、防火墙规则等。
如果你使用阿里云的虚拟主机服务,你可以为你的网站分配一个IP地址,如192.168.1.100,你可以注册多个域名,如example.com、sub.example.com等,这些域名都会指向同一个IP地址。
虚拟主机的优势
尽管虚拟主机没有独立的IP地址,但它们仍然提供了极大的优势,虚拟主机可以让你在一台物理服务器上运行多个网站,节省了物理服务器的数量,虚拟主机允许你为每个域名分配独立的域名解析,这意味着每个域名可以有自己的独立解析表项,从而避免域名冲突的问题。
虚拟主机还支持负载均衡,确保多个域名可以共享相同的网络资源,提高服务器的性能和稳定性。
虚拟主机并没有独立的IP地址,它们共享同一个IP地址,通过域名解析将多个域名映射到同一个IP地址上,这种设计使得虚拟主机能够支持多个域名,同时共享相同的网络资源,从而提高了资源的利用率和管理的效率。
如果你还有其他关于虚拟主机的问题,欢迎继续提问!
卡尔云官网
www.kaeryun.com